2026 Magical Almanac
Client: Llewellyn Worldwide ·Sue Todd was commissioned to contribute 8 black and white illustrations to the 2026 Magical Almanac. It was a dream come true to be invited to participate in a project that she has admired for years. The client gave Sue free rein to interpret the text and she rendered the art in her new digital ink technique using Procreate on the iPad.

Sue Todd is a Toronto based illustrator living in two worlds, the analog and the digital. Sue has literally carved out a niche with her lino-cut technique which she then colors digitally, thus enjoying a variety of activities to fire her passion for problem solving with imagery. Among Sue’s influences are medieval woodcuts, the art of Jim Flora, and the woodcuts of Frans Masereel and Jose Francisco Borges. Sue’s colorful art has appeared in books, magazines, posters, t-shirts, a TV commercial and on a bus. Sue is exploring the world of graphic novels by writing and illustrating her own stories, presently works in progress. For relaxation, Sue paints oil portraits, both analog and digital.
